PROUD FATHER – A tribute from a member of the LGBTQIA+ community to his father, who is very supportive of his pursuits in life such as joining beauty pageants, has gone viral on social media.

In a TikTok post, Violet Huelar, a gay son from Laguna, shared a video compilation of clips showcasing his experiences in pageants and studies, where his father, Toto, is always supportive.

Some clips in the video include Huelar being crowned by his happy and proud father, his father assisting him off the stage, and his father proudly wearing the medal he received after being a top 5 outstanding student in their school. In the final part of the video, Huelar’s performance is shown while his father, Papa Toto, watches and proudly says, “That’s my child.”

Netizens widely admired and emotionally reacted to the video, highlighting the profound impact of a father’s love and support. They emphasized the confidence and love Violet received from his father, the extraordinary nature of paternal love, and their own aspirations to be supportive parents. Many were moved to tears, noting that such support helps children achieve their best selves. They also expressed a wish for similar acceptance and love for all LGBTQIA+ individuals.

Meanwhile, the LGBTQIA+ community is an inclusive term covering a diverse range of individuals with various sexual orientations and gender identities. The acronym represents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Queer or Questioning, Intersex, and Asexual, with the plus sign (+) signifying additional orientations and identities.

Lesbians are women who form romantic bonds with other women, while gays are men who do the same with men, and bisexuals can have connections with both genders. Transgender individuals identify differently from their assigned sex at birth, while queer refers broadly to those not identifying as heterosexual or cisgender, and questioning denotes those exploring their orientation or gender.
